MENTAL HEALTH ADMITTED PATIENT CLASSIFICATION

The classification of the admitted PATIENT during a Ward Stay for the Mental Health Services Data Set.

Description

National Codes

Code Description
10 Acute adult mental health care
11 Acute older adult mental health care (organic and functional)
12 Adult Psychiatric Intensive Care Unit (acute mental health care)
13 Adult Eating Disorders
14 Mother and baby
15

Adult Learning Disabilities

16 Adult Low secure/locked rehabilitation (Retired 1 October 2021)
17 Adult High dependency rehabilitation
18 Adult Long term complex rehabilitation/ Continuing Care (Retired 1 October 2021)
19 Adult Low secure
20 Adult Medium secure
21 Adult High secure
22 Adult Neuro-psychiatry / Acquired Brain Injury
